"Over the Next Hill" released in 2004, is an album by the band Fairport Convention. It has been described by Mojo as "simply [Fairport's] best album in 25 years". The album was recorded during March and April 2004 at Dave Pegg's Woodworm Studio, Barford St. Michael, Oxfordshire, UK. It was engineered and mixed by Mark Tucker, and the executive producer was Dave Pegg. It was the first release on the band's newly created Matty Grooves label.
